Protect your life insurance payout from Inheritance Tax
An increasing number of estates are falling within the tax net every year
An increasing number of estates are falling within the Inheritance Tax net each year, largely due to rising property prices and frozen tax thresholds. The Office for Budget Responsibility forecasts that HM Revenue & Customs (HMRC) will collect £8.7 billion in Inheritance Tax for the 2025/26 tax year[1].
‘Unretiring’ is reshaping our understanding of later life
Has the financial reality of retirement fallen short of expectations?
Amid rising living costs and market uncertainty, ‘unretiring’ is a growing trend. Research shows that one in six retirees (16%) have either returned to work (8%) or are strongly considering doing so (8%)[1]. While some return for personal fulfilment, 24% cite loneliness or social disconnection as key reasons.

How to approach risk as an investor
Understanding risk tolerance and the capacity to make smarter investment decisions
From stocks to bonds and everything in between, every investment carries some degree of uncertainty. When we talk about risk, we generally refer to the possibility that your investments might not perform exactly as you expect. For some, this means watching an investment’s value fall. For others, it is the silent threat of their hard-earned money losing purchasing power due to inflation.
